What Is an ACR EPIRB?

An ACR EPIRB is an emergency beacon designed to transmit a distress signal via the international COSPAS-SARSAT satellite network when activated. It helps rescue services locate a vessel quickly, even in remote offshore locations.

Unlike standard communication devices, an EPIRB continues transmitting even when other onboard systems fail, making it one of the most dependable pieces of Marine safety supplies available today.

Understanding Emergency Position Indicating Radio Beacons

An Emergency Position Indicating Radio Beacon is specifically built for maritime emergencies. Once activated, it sends a unique identification code and, on GPS-enabled models, the vessel's precise location.

The distress signal is received by satellites and forwarded to rescue coordination centres, allowing emergency responders to launch rescue operations with accurate location information.

Most modern EPIRBs operate on:

  • 406 MHz distress frequency

  • 121.5 MHz homing frequency

  • GPS positioning for improved accuracy

  • High-intensity LED strobe lights for visual identification

Automatic vs Manual Activation

There are two main activation methods.

Automatic Activation (Category I)

These EPIRBs deploy automatically if the vessel sinks. They are ideal for commercial vessels and offshore operations where immediate activation is critical.

Manual Activation (Category II)

These models require manual release and activation, making them suitable for smaller recreational boats and leisure craft.

406 MHz and 121.5 MHz Transmission

Modern EPIRBs use dual frequencies.

  • 406 MHz transmits the distress alert through satellites.

  • 121.5 MHz assists rescue teams during the final stages of locating the vessel.

Together, these frequencies improve rescue efficiency.

ACR EPIRB vs Personal Locator Beacon (PLB)

Although both devices are designed to help rescue services locate people during emergencies, they serve different purposes. Understanding the differences will help you select the right equipment for your vessel.

Feature

ACR EPIRB

Personal Locator Beacon (PLB)

Intended Use

Protects the entire vessel

Protects an individual

Registration

Registered to a vessel

Registered to an individual

Activation

Manual or automatic (depending on model)

Manual

Battery Life

Longer operational life

Shorter operational life

Best For

Commercial and recreational boats

Crew members, kayakers, sailors

For most vessel owners, an ACR EPIRB should be considered an essential item within their Marine safety supplies, while a PLB can provide an additional layer of personal safety for crew members.

ACR EPIRB Registration Requirements in the UK

Buying an ACR EPIRB is only part of the process. Proper registration is equally important.

When your beacon is registered, search and rescue authorities receive valuable information about your vessel, helping them respond more effectively during an emergency.

Registration also allows authorities to:

  • Identify your vessel quickly

  • Contact your emergency contacts

  • Verify distress alerts

  • Reduce delays during rescue operations

Keep your registration details updated whenever there is a change in ownership, vessel name, or contact information.

EPIRB Maintenance and Inspection Tips

Like all Marine safety supplies, an ACR EPIRB requires regular maintenance to remain reliable.

Perform Regular Self-Tests

Most EPIRBs include a built-in self-test feature.

Regular testing helps confirm:

  • Battery status

  • GPS functionality

  • Signal performance

  • Overall device health

Always follow the manufacturer's testing schedule to avoid unnecessary transmissions.

Replace the Battery on Time

EPIRB batteries are designed for long-term reliability, but they eventually expire.

Replace the battery:

  • Before the expiry date

  • After activation

  • Through an authorised service centre where required

Inspect the Hydrostatic Release Unit (HRU)

If you own a Category I beacon, inspect the Hydrostatic Release Unit regularly and replace it according to the manufacturer's recommendations.

Check the Mounting Bracket

Ensure the beacon:

  • Is securely mounted

  • Is free from corrosion

  • Can be easily removed during an emergency

  • Has no visible damage

Proper storage and inspection help ensure your emergency beacon performs when it matters most.
